Output dd43a37af6b847d851e0237f053bf985095efe76e8e6f3b53b302bea98a91426:2

value
88596911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374b82432122a891556bae0c8d99bf31916b8 OP_EQUAL
address
3BMEXJQJT8PDLUG5NtUZET9L6yHC8413YL
transaction
dd43a37af6b847d851e0237f053bf985095efe76e8e6f3b53b302bea98a91426
spent
true